Description
This vise is designed to provide maximum stability and precision, solving the common flexing and jamming issues found in most 3D-printed vises.
1. Design and Mechanical Strength
- 3-Guide System: The triple-guide structure ensures perfect linear translation. This eliminates lateral wobble and prevents the moving jaw from binding or locking up during tightening.
- Screw Orientation: To ensure maximum structural strength, the screws must be printed horizontally. This allows the layers to run along the length of the screw, providing significantly higher tensile and torsional resistance compared to vertical printing, where threads risk snapping between layers.
2. Capacity and Dimensions
- Table Mounting: The vise is compatible with surfaces ranging from 5 mm to 32 mm in thickness. The mounting screw has a maximum opening of 35 mm.
- Jaw Capacity: It can securely clamp objects up to 50 mm wide.
3. Print Settings and Materials
- Structure (PETG): PETG is highly recommended for its excellent mechanical strength and low tendency for plastic deformation under constant load (creep).
- Walls: At least 3.
- Infill (Body): 15% to 30%.
- Infill (Screws): Set strictly to 100% for maximum thread durability.
- Interchangeable Pads (TPU): Print these in flexible material to increase grip and protect your workpieces.
- Standard/Rigid Use: Infill between 50% and 100%.
- Delicate Use: For fragile components, use a 15-20% infill to create a cushioning effect.
4. Assembly and Maintenance
The model features very tight tolerances to prevent the vise from "wobbling" or loosening accidentally. For optimal performance:
- Lubrication: It is essential to apply a thin layer of grease (lithium or silicone) to the moving parts, specifically inside the guide tracks and on the screw threads.
- Benefits: Grease facilitates smooth sliding, reduces friction, and prevents premature wear of the plastic contact points, ensuring a professional-grade feel.
